Mizzou Athletics is set to introduce a comprehensive financial education program this fall aimed at empowering its student athletes. This initiative will focus on providing essential knowledge and skills that are crucial for managing finances effectively.
The program will feature a series of workshops designed to cover various topics, including budgeting, investing, and understanding credit. In addition to these workshops, personalized tutoring sessions will be available to help student athletes navigate their unique financial situations.
Recognizing the importance of financial literacy, Mizzou Athletics aims to equip its athletes with the tools they need to make informed financial decisions both during and after their collegiate careers. This initiative reflects a growing trend among educational institutions to prioritize the holistic development of student athletes, ensuring they are well-prepared for life beyond sports. Through this program, Mizzou is taking a significant step towards fostering responsible financial habits and long-term success for its student athletes.
